教育科技行业教育软件开发工程师岗位招聘考试试卷及答案.docVIP

教育科技行业教育软件开发工程师岗位招聘考试试卷及答案.doc

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

教育科技行业教育软件开发工程师岗位招聘考试试卷及答案

填空题

1.Java是一种跨平台的________语言。(答案:面向对象)

2.SpringBoot框架主要用于开发________应用。(答案:后端)

3.MySQL是一种________型数据库管理系统。(答案:关系)

4.前端开发中,________用于构建用户界面。(答案:HTML)

5.教育软件中,________功能可实现学生学习行为的跟踪分析。(答案:学习分析)

6.Git是一种分布式________工具。(答案:版本控制)

7.软件开发中,________测试关注单个模块的独立功能。(答案:单元)

8.RESTfulAPI设计中,常用________方法表示资源获取。(答案:GET)

9.教育软件的核心用户群体包括学生、教师和________。(答案:管理员)

10.微服务架构的特点是将应用拆分为________的服务单元。(答案:独立部署)

单项选择题

1.以下属于编译型语言的是()

A.PythonB.JavaScriptC.JavaD.PHP

(答案:C)

2.HTTP状态码中,表示请求成功的是()

A.404B.200C.500D.302

(答案:B)

3.数据库索引的主要作用是()

A.增加数据冗余B.提高查询效率C.减少存储空间D.简化表结构

(答案:B)

4.以下不属于前端框架的是()

A.ReactB.VueC.DjangoD.Angular

(答案:C)

5.敏捷开发中,迭代周期通常为()

A.1-4周B.1-3个月C.半年D.一年

(答案:A)

6.教育软件中,“学情分析”模块的核心数据来源是()

A.教师教案B.学生作业提交记录C.系统日志D.课程大纲

(答案:B)

7.API设计中,“单一职责”原则指每个接口()

A.只处理一种资源操作B.支持多种数据格式C.必须有身份验证D.可跨域访问

(答案:A)

8.以下工具中,用于代码版本控制的是()

A.JiraB.GitC.JenkinsD.Docker

(答案:B)

9.软件测试中,“验收测试”的执行主体是()

A.开发人员B.测试人员C.用户D.项目经理

(答案:C)

10.微服务架构与单体架构相比,优势在于()

A.部署简单B.开发效率高C.服务独立扩展D.代码耦合度高

(答案:C)

多项选择题

1.以下属于后端开发常用编程语言的有()

A.JavaB.PythonC.ReactD.Go

(答案:ABD)

2.前端开发技术栈通常包括()

A.CSSB.Node.jsC.JavaScriptD.SQL

(答案:ABC)

3.数据库按数据模型分类,可分为()

A.关系型数据库B.文档型数据库C.键值型数据库D.编译型数据库

(答案:ABC)

4.教育软件的核心功能模块可能包括()

A.课程管理B.在线考试C.数据分析D.硬件驱动

(答案:ABC)

5.软件测试阶段包括()

A.单元测试B.集成测试C.系统测试D.验收测试

(答案:ABCD)

6.Git的常用操作包括()

A.commitB.pushC.mergeD.compile

(答案:ABC)

7.RESTfulAPI的特点有()

A.无状态B.资源为中心C.使用HTTP方法D.强制使用XML格式

(答案:ABC)

8.敏捷开发的核心角色包括()

A.产品负责人B.开发团队C.测试工程师D.ScrumMaster

(答案:ABD)

9.教育数据隐私保护需遵循的法规可能包括()

A.GDPRB.网络安全法C.个人信息保护法D.著作权法

(答案:ABC)

10.微服务架构的优势包括()

A.独立部署B.技术栈灵活C.故障隔离D.开发效率低

(答案:ABC)

判断题

1.JavaScript是一种编译型编程语言。(答案:×)

2.MySQL属于关系型数据库。(答案:√)

3.React是一种后端开发框架。(答案:×)

4.单元测试主要关注模块的独立功能是否正常。(答案:√)

5.教育软件无需考虑无障碍设计。(答案:×)

6.Git的commit操作会直接将代码提交到远程仓库。(答案:×)

7.HTTP协议是无状态协议。(答案:√)

8.NoSQL数据库完全不支持事务处理。(答案:×)

9.瀑布模型适合需求频繁变化的软件开发项目。(答案:×)

10.教育数据分析可用于生成个性化学习路径。(答案:√)

简答题

1.简述教育软件的核心功能模块。

(答案:教育软件核心功能模块通常包括:课程管理(课程创建、发布、更新)、学习互动(在线讨论、直播课堂)、作业与考试(布置、提交、自动批改)、学习分析(行为数据统计、成绩分析)、用户管理(角色权限、账号维护)。这些模块需协同满足教与学的全流程需求,支持个性化学习与教学管理。)

2.软件开发中,如何保证代码

文档评论(0)

试卷文库 + 关注
实名认证
文档贡献者

竭诚服务

1亿VIP精品文档

相关文档